Scotchtown is a small hamlet located in the town of Wallkill in Orange County, New York. This charming community is steeped in history and offers a peaceful and picturesque setting for its residents and visitors. With a population of approximately 9,000 people, Scotchtown is a close-knit and welcoming community.

The area was settled in the 18th century, and its rich history is still evident in its well-preserved historic buildings and landmarks.
